Дескриптор ICU MessageFormat select с пустым аргументом - PullRequest
1 голос
/ 22 марта 2019

Я хочу перевести текст, используя ICU MessageFormat, обрабатывающий сложные аргументы , но я не нахожу способ добавить запись выбора для пустой строки / нулевого аргумента:

{variable, select,
  empty {The translation when variable is null / blank} 
  other {The translation when variable is not null}
}

Я хочу отобразить перевод empty, если дано variable пустое значение, но я не могу найти правильный синтаксис для этого.

Возвращает синтаксическую ошибку:

{variable, select,
  '' {The translation when variable is null / blank} 
  other {The translation when variable is not null}
}

Я использую ICU MessageFormat с PHP.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...